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
648255485 77 97429
411 8353 36505994
411 8353 36505994
5865951 46842 1249816477
All about undefined
Interested in learning more?
411 8353 36505994
5865951 46842 1249816477
See more
0220319359 02 7833145620
64353331 542 65032935
See more
73196985 858
5894 880 106833 232 460
See more